Fifteen-year-old Enrique grows up with his grandmother in a forgotten Slovak village, while his mother Martina works in a distant city and rarely finds time to visit her son. Summer passes slowly, and lanky Enrique shortens the wait for his mother by riding mopeds and getting into minor mischief with his friends. At the same time, he conscientiously fulfills his mother's tasks—at first without question, but soon he begins to suspect that they are not as innocent as they seemed. Rumors about Martina spread throughout the village, and Enrique gradually begins to doubt the image he has created of his mother. The story is inspired by real events in the "hungry" Slovak valleys and features non-actors in the leading roles.
